Materials You’ll Need
Gathering your materials creates an inviting atmosphere. Here’s what you will need for your coffee filter jellyfish mobile:
- White coffee filters (easy to find at most grocery stores)
- Colored markers or watercolor paints (for vibrant hues)
- Scissors (for cutting with ease)
- String or fishing line (for suspension)
- A circular stick or dowel (to hang your mobile)
- Optional: Glue or tape (for additional stability)

Step-by-Step Directions
-
Start with a coffee filter laid flat. The texture is soft and smooth, inviting you to touch it.
-
Use colored markers or watercolor paints to embellish the filter. Let your creativity flow as you create waves of color; notice how the colors blend and soak into the paper.
-
Once your filter is dry, fold it in half, then in half again. The folds create layers, adding depth to your jellyfish.
-
With scissors, gently round the edges of the folded coffee filter. These curves resemble the bell of a jellyfish.
-
Unfold the filter to reveal your beautiful jellyfish shape. Each layer has a delicate form, dancing through the air.
-
Cut several strands of string or fishing line, adjusting the lengths to create a sense of movement. Attach one end of each string to the top of your jellyfish.
-
Gather all your jellyfish. Tie the loose ends of the string to a circular stick or dowel. The stick serves as a lovely base, allowing your jellyfish to sway freely.
-
Hang your completed mobile in a place where it can catch the light. Watch as the jellyfish gently dance in the breeze, filling your space with calming beauty.

Gentle Tips & Variations
To make this DIY uniquely yours, consider these gentle variations:
-
Experiment with different colors and patterns. Try using pastels for a soft look or vibrant primary colors for a playful feel. Each jellyfish can tell its own story.
-
Explore using natural dyes from fruits and vegetables. This can add an organic touch and connects the making process with seasonal rhythms.
-
Experiment with varying the size of the jellyfish. Some could be small and delicate, while others are larger, creating a dynamic mobile that dances with life.
-
Incorporate beads or small shells at the ends of the strings for added detail. The smooth surfaces can catch the light beautifully, enhancing the peaceful atmosphere.

What types of paints work best on coffee filters?
Watercolor paints work wonderfully as they soak gently into the filters, creating a soft blend of colors. Markers provide vivid detail but may result in more defined patterns.
Can I hang my mobile outdoors?
While the coffee filters look lovely outside, sunlight and moisture may affect the colors. It’s best to place them in a sheltered space to maintain their beauty.
How do I clean the filters if they get dusty?
A gentle dusting with a soft cloth can restore their appearance. For deeper cleaning, a light spritz of water can help, but avoid soaking.
